📋 Nutrition Summary
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t contains 149.6 calories per serving (1 Serving (170.0g)), a moderate amount that fits easily into most daily calorie goals. Carbohydrates are the primary energy source at 15.0g per serving (41.1% of calories), of which 13.0g are sugars. It provides a noteworthy 321.3mg of calcium (25% DV), contributing to bone and dental health.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t
Is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t good for weight loss?
At 150 calories and 8g of protein per serving, this yogurt can fit into a weight loss plan if portions are controlled. The 13g of sugar is relatively high for the serving size, so you'd want to account for that in your daily intake rather than treating it as a free food.
Is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t good for muscle building?
With 8g of protein per 170g serving, this yogurt provides a decent protein boost for muscle recovery, especially when paired with other protein sources. The carbohydrates also help replenish glycogen after workouts.
Is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t suitable for people with lactose intolerance?
While yogurt is often easier to digest than milk due to the fermentation process breaking down much of the lactose, this product still contains whole milk and nonfat milk as primary ingredients. People with lactose intolerance should start with a small amount to see how they tolerate it, or choose a dairy-free alternative.
What diets does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t suit?
This works well for Mediterranean, flexitarian, and general balanced diets. It's suitable for vegetarians and those seeking probiotics for gut health, though the added sugars make it less ideal for strict keto or low-carb approaches.
What should I watch out for with Vanilla Organic Probiotic Whole Milk Yogurt?
The sugar content at 13g per serving is notable—more than half comes from added sweeteners like maple syrup and honey rather than lactose alone. If you're monitoring sugar intake or managing blood sugar, you may want a lower-sugar yogurt option.
